adopt a wrong method to save a situation and end up by making it worse
Baoxinjiufen, a Chinese idiom, Pinyin is B à ox à NJI à f é n, which means to eliminate calamities in a wrong way, and the calamities will expand instead. It comes from the biography of Tao Qian in the annals of the Three Kingdoms.
The origin of Idioms
In the biography of Tao Qian, Wei Zhi of the Three Kingdoms, Pei Songzhi quoted Wu Weizhao of the Three Kingdoms as saying, "it's different to save the fire and stop the fire by holding on to one's salary."
